A 20:1 signal attenuator designed to support automotive performance measurement, including measuring fuel injector and primary ignition waveforms. It offers a bandwidth of 10 MHz. Because the signal is attenuated, using the attenuator, the oscilloscope can measure voltages higher than its range (±20V). Provides increased protection against input overload.

Rogowski-type current probe for precise measurements of alternating currents with a frequency of up to 30 MHz. Thanks to the flexible coil of 1.6 mm thickness and almost zero impedance introduced, it is ideal for work in hard-to-reach places of power systems. The integrated amplifier and BNC interface enable accurate measurements and easy integration with oscilloscopes, making it an ideal tool for R&D laboratories and power electronics services.
